With the continuous development of industry, the demand for ball valves under severe working conditions such as high temperatures and high pressure is increasing. Under these severe working conditions, ball valves need to have better wear resistance, erosion resistance, high-temperature resistance and corrosion resistance. However, the service life, cost and performance of traditional
ball valves still cannot meet the harsh working conditions of industrial silicon, coal chemical industry, gas and so on.
A double eccentric hemispherical ball valve is a new
valve developed by taking advantages of ball valves with different structures. It adopts double eccentric sealing structure, and has the advantages of small wear, small torque, good sealing performance and long service life. The valve seat and hemisphere are treated by special hardening processes to meet the requirements of wear resistance, erosion resistance, corrosion resistance and high-temperature resistance under severe working conditions.
